Question:
I need a simple program to resize pictures with any suggestions?

I use IrfanView. You can get it free at http://www.irfanview.com/. It's relatively simple, just File>Open to select pic, then Image > Resize brings up your resize options. Resize options can be done in pixels, cm or inches. Hopefully someone else can elaborate more on resizing rules regarding pixels vs. inches etc, or suggest even easier programs.
